Do you have a plan to be able to provide proven results for your sales arsenal? Maybe some of the folks you are providing samples to can give you some "certified" testimonials. IOW's, this product will increase your driving distance by x amount and your accuracy by x amount. Also, some short before and after videos would serve you well.

Great questions and ideas. My options for this include: testimonials from other golf professionals, mini tour players, big name teachers and PGA tour players.

Other professionals and mini tour players will be easy as I have a network of them who would help out. However, who is really gonna care what these people say right? It’s like seeing a book endorsed by 50 people you’ve never heard of, doesn’t make you want to read it any more than you already did.

I do have some contacts with big name teachers and pga tour professionals who I’ve met, worked with, and golfed with in the past where people would actually recognize the names so that is my best option for adding credibilty to the product prior to gathering user reviews.
